Best Time to Visit

  • October to February: This is the ideal season, with pleasant weather and stunning views.
  • March to June: Expect hot and humid conditions, but enjoy fewer crowds and lower rates.
  • Monsoon Season (July to September): The rains create lush landscapes, but some houseboats may be unavailable. This season offers a tranquil atmosphere and vibrant scenery.

Types of Houseboats

  • Luxury Houseboats: Featuring upscale amenities, air conditioning, and gourmet meals for a premium experience.
  • Standard Houseboats: Comfortable and budget-friendly, providing basic facilities and a cozy atmosphere.
  • Traditional Kettuvallams: These authentic wooden boats, once used for rice transport, now serve as charming accommodations.

Getting There

  • Nearest Airport: Kochi International Airport (COK) is the closest major airport.
  • Transportation: You can hire a taxi or use local transport to reach popular departure points like Alleppey or Kumarakom.
